    Position Summary: The Sustainable Ohio Public Energy Council ("SOPEC") seeks candidates for the position of Grants Manager. SOPEC was established in 2014 and serves member communities and political subdivisions across Ohio. The position will assist in continued development of, and growth and service to, SOPEC member communities and political subdivisions. SOPEC has a strong commitment to sustainability and the advancement of the renewable energy economy. SOPEC is governed by the members it serves.

    Job Description: Duties may include, but are not limited to, the following:

    ● Responsible for the creation, preparation, and execution of post-award contracts and agreements;

    ● Coordinate and work with appropriate SOPEC staff to ensure all grant requirements are being met in how the award and project/program are being administered and implemented;

    ● Maintain grant records in grant management software;

    ● Support program/project staff, administration, and finance staff in grant-related duties and tasks;

    ● Oversee programmatic and fiscal compliance throughout the life cycle of the grant, for SOPEC and any grant-funded partners and subrecipients;

    ● Be fully knowledgeable and advise on 2 CFR Part 200 and ensure all requirements are being applied throughout the grant process; ● Provide grant team support as requested; and

    ● Serving local member communities and political subdivisions.

    Responsibility: The Grants Manager reports to the Director of Grants and Development. Highly responsible, mid-management position with some independence requiring judgment and sensitivity to the organization and public relations. Personal Work Relationships: The Grants Manager will have daily contact with co-workers in the organization, elected and appointed officials, members of the news media, and the general public. The purpose of these contacts is to provide helpful information about the activities of the organization and to promote strong public relations for the organization.

    Working Conditions: Work is performed in a normal office setting and/or remotely. Work is also sometimes performed at local government meetings across Ohio, and some occasional driving and travel time may be required.

    Compensation: This position is full-time and benefits eligible, including required contribution by employee and employer to the Ohio Public Employees Retirement System (OPERS). A background check will be required.
